Red Tent Fund's Journey: One Year of Empowering Togetherness

Celebrating a Year of Impact
Rooted in Jewish values, Red Tent Fund proudly marks its one-year anniversary, reflecting on its mission to enhance access to abortion care. This nonprofit organization was established in 2024, offering direct financial assistance for abortion procedures without restrictions based on religion, income, or identity.
Expanding Access
Since its inception, the Red Tent Fund has distributed over $230,000 in abortion care funding, which has enabled hundreds to secure essential reproductive healthcare. With a focus on exceeding $500,000 in total funding for the coming year, the organization is ramping up efforts to improve access at a time when reproductive rights are under threat.

Building Community Support
The Fund not only provides financial assistance but is also attentive to the needs of the community it serves. By prioritizing block grants to clinics, they minimize direct financial burdens on both clients and medical facilities, thus facilitating smoother access to care. This approach contrasts with traditional methods that often involve lengthy processes for applicants.
Supporting Clinics Strategically
Currently, the Fund collaborates with seven clinics nationally, located in areas where access to abortion services is particularly vital. This initiative represents a strategic decision to streamline funding directly at the point of care, and plans are in place to broaden this support network further in the near future.
